    Have you ever found yourself lost while driving or walking and in need of a straightforward route to your destination? A sentence that includes the instruction “go straight” provides a clear directive to continue in the same direction without turning.

    In navigating both literal and figurative paths, the phrase “go straight” serves as a simple and unambiguous command to maintain course without any deviations. This common expression is often employed in giving directions, offering guidance, or emphasizing the importance of staying focused and not veering off track.

    7 Examples Of Go Straight Used In a Sentence For Kids

    1. Go straight and you will reach the playground.
    2. You can go straight to the front of the line.
    3. Go straight and you will find your classroom.
    4. Let’s go straight to the library for story time.
    5. Go straight until you see the big tree.
    6. Go straight and you will see the school gates.
    7. Remember to go straight when walking in the hallway.
